Historically, one of the most time-consuming and admin-heavy aspects of running a construction business is quoting. You could spend hours with plans spread out over your desk, methodically taking measurements, and writing up the quantities of the materials youโ€™re going to need to complete the job. 

Then, youโ€™re on the phone, online or flicking through printed catalogues to cost everything up. Not only is it time-consuming, but it also has a high margin of error. Measure something incorrectly, or price it wrongly and you run the risk of losing money on the job, or not winning it because your quoteโ€™s too high.

Add to this the extra time youโ€™ll need to spend if your customer changes their mind on elements of the build. More measuring, more pricing, more quoting. More time that could be better spent on other new jobs, with the family or even on the golf course!

The first thing youโ€™ll do is upload a pdf of the plans to your computer. Then, all the measuring is done with a few clicks of your mouse. The takeoff software uses the information from the plan to automatically create a list of the exact materials required for the job, and it assigns costs to each item from its cost database, or it can connect directly with your preferred supplier for a live highly accurate price list.

It really is that simple. Youโ€™ll find yourself doing 80% faster takeoffs, and you can put away your pencil, calculator, and ruler forever!

With your takeoff and pricing complete, Buildxact will generate a professional-looking quote for you to present to your customer. And if they make changes, no problem, youโ€™re only a few clicks away from generating an amended quote.
